无线抄表与服务器,基于Modbus协议的远程无线抄表系统的设计与实现

摘要:

随着人民生活水平的日益提高,智能计量表在日常生活和工作中的使用越来越普及。但是传统人工抄表需要消耗大量的人力和物力,并且抄表人员需亲临现场或恶劣的环境,鉴于安全性和便捷性的考虑,远程智能抄表系统就应运而生。 本文设计与实现了一种基于3G上网的Modbus远程抄表系统,包括了服务器,抄表设备和数据采集设备(RTU设备)。本文采用Linux服务器,通过Modbus/TCP协议与抄表设备进行数据交互,并利用MySQL数据库存储抄表数据。抄表设备选择嵌入式Linux操作系统,采用ARM9处理芯片和华为EM770W3G模块接入WCDMA网络。 抄表设备与服务器间采用TCP/IP进行数据通信,实现Modbus/TCP协议;抄表设备与RTU设备之间的数据通信采用RS485,通信协议为Modbus/RS485协议;同时,抄表设备完成Modbus/TCP和Modbus/RS485协议之间的转换。由Linux脚本完成3G拨号上网及PPP自动检测网络,当断网或者Ping不通时自动重拨。整个抄表系统的数据传输实现了透明传输,并且抄表设备能快速检测到3G网络的非正常断开并自动重连,保证系统稳定持久运行。

展开

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值